border no CSS base

3 participantes

Ver o tópico anterior Ver o tópico seguinte Ir para baixo

Tópico resolvido border no CSS base

Mensagem por Eduardo Lima 15.05.18 2:11

Detalhes da questão


Endereço do fórum: http://www.brasilplayforever.com/forum
Versão do fórum: ModernBB

Descrição


Olá,

No CSS base do meu fórum existe este código:
Código:
#preview .postbody table, #preview .postbody td, div[class*='post--'] .postbody table, div[class*='post--'] .postbody td {
   border: 1px solid #444!important
}
E isso é um problema pois se uso tags BBCode table, fica com borda #444 bem ridículo: https://i.imgur.com/1lIZN4r.png

Eu tentei usar o display: none na borda no CSS, só que aí fica sem nenhuma borda, mesmo eu estabelecendo uma no código no tópico... só aparece se eu usar declaração !important, mas é um saco ter que usar sempre.

Então, teria algum jeito de tirar esse CSS base do fórum?
avatar

Eduardo Lima
****

Membro desde : 07/03/2016
Mensagens : 243
Pontos : 380

http://www.brasilplayforever.com/forum

Ir para o topo Ir para baixo

Principal Contribuidor

Tópico resolvido Re: border no CSS base

Mensagem por Shek 15.05.18 10:54

Olá!

Eu acessei o fórum e não encontrei essa falha citada. Você poderia verificar se a URL do fórum está correta?

Até mais.
Shek

Shek
Principal Contribuidor
Principal Contribuidor

Membro desde : 11/04/2009
Mensagens : 19006
Pontos : 22969

https://shiftactive.blogspot.com/ https://www.facebook.com/ShiftActif https://twitter.com/ShiftActif

Ir para o topo Ir para baixo

Tópico resolvido Re: border no CSS base

Mensagem por Eduardo Lima 15.05.18 23:02

Estava com o display:none, mas agora tirei.
Acesse esse tópico e verás: http://www.brasilplayforever.com/t166624-

o/


Ps: Pode ser que dê um erro ao acessar o tópico, mas é só recarregar a página que abrirá normalmente.
avatar

Eduardo Lima
****

Membro desde : 07/03/2016
Mensagens : 243
Pontos : 380

http://www.brasilplayforever.com/forum

Ir para o topo Ir para baixo

Principal Contribuidor

Tópico resolvido Re: border no CSS base

Mensagem por Shek 16.05.18 0:43

Olá!

Poderia colar o seu código CSS aqui por favor? O código informado está incluso no CSS, e não no base do fórum (pelo que diz meu console).
Shek

Shek
Principal Contribuidor
Principal Contribuidor

Membro desde : 11/04/2009
Mensagens : 19006
Pontos : 22969

https://shiftactive.blogspot.com/ https://www.facebook.com/ShiftActif https://twitter.com/ShiftActif

Ir para o topo Ir para baixo

Tópico resolvido Re: border no CSS base

Mensagem por Eduardo Lima 16.05.18 1:14

No meu console mostra ser o CSS base... e também é só olhar aqui: http://www.brasilplayforever.com/56-ltr.css?pop=1 e procurar por border: 1px solid #444!important

Único código que eu coloquei foi esse para não ficar mostrando essas bordas
Código:
#preview .postbody table, #preview .postbody td, div[class*='post--'] .postbody table, div[class*='post--'] .postbody td {
  border: none !important
}


o/


Última edição por Eduardo Lima em 16.05.18 1:54, editado 1 vez(es)
avatar

Eduardo Lima
****

Membro desde : 07/03/2016
Mensagens : 243
Pontos : 380

http://www.brasilplayforever.com/forum

Ir para o topo Ir para baixo

Principal Contribuidor

Tópico resolvido Re: border no CSS base

Mensagem por Shek 16.05.18 1:20

Olá!

Você tentou usar a borda contra ela mesma? Tente adicionar este código acima de todo o seu CSS, por favor:
Código:
#preview .postbody table, #preview .postbody td, div[class*='post--'] .postbody table, div[class*='post--'] .postbody td {
    border: transparent !important;
}
Atenciosamente,
Shek King
Shek

Shek
Principal Contribuidor
Principal Contribuidor

Membro desde : 11/04/2009
Mensagens : 19006
Pontos : 22969

https://shiftactive.blogspot.com/ https://www.facebook.com/ShiftActif https://twitter.com/ShiftActif

Ir para o topo Ir para baixo

Tópico resolvido Re: border no CSS base

Mensagem por Eduardo Lima 16.05.18 1:32

Deixa eu tentar explicar de novo, pode ter ficado meio confuso.

Assim, este tópico utiliza esse código:
Código:
[table style="border: 1px solid #4080FF; padding: 10px 10px 10px 10px; width: 90%; margin-left: 5%; margin-right: 5%; border-radius: 10px 10px 10px 10px; -moz-border-radius: 10px 10px 10px 10px; -webkit-border-radius: 10px 10px 10px 10px; border-radius: 10px 10px 5px #A0A0A0; -moz-border-radius: 10px 10px 5px #A0A0A0; -webkit-border-radius: 10px 10px 5px #A0A0A0;"]
[tr style=][td]→ [url=http://www.brasilplayforever.com/t269606-regras-servidor-parte-geral]Parte Geral[/url][/td]
[/tr]
[/table]
E teria que dar esse resultado: https://i.imgur.com/tpDzhtR.png mas não dá pois no CSS base do próprio fórum possui esse código que está com a declaração !important e impossibilitando que eu formate o meu código no próprio post, só se eu também usar a mesma declaração, mas iria ficar bem chato ter que usar toda vez.
Este código:
Código:
#preview .postbody table,#preview .postbody td,div[class*='post--'] .postbody table,div[class*='post--'] .postbody td {
   border:1px solid #444!important
}
Este código base faz com que fique assim o meu outro código: https://i.imgur.com/OIiu9wM.png. Já tentei fazer o que você disse, colocar o display: transparent !important, mas aí esse ficará com vantagem no código por estar usando a declaração !important, ou seja, irá ficar sem borda mesmo eu especificando uma borda no código do tópico.

O que eu quero dizer sobre isso tudo, esse código que está no CSS base, além de não ser útil, está dificultando a formatação de códigos no fórum, como esse do tópico, por exemplo.

Só queria tirar esse código, não quero ele, não serve pra nada, mas creio que não temos como editar o CSS base do fórum, ou temos? I don't know.
avatar

Eduardo Lima
****

Membro desde : 07/03/2016
Mensagens : 243
Pontos : 380

http://www.brasilplayforever.com/forum

Ir para o topo Ir para baixo

Principal Contribuidor

Tópico resolvido Re: border no CSS base

Mensagem por Shek 16.05.18 4:38

Bom dia!

Entendi... Mas, mesmo declarando o transparent sem o important na folha de estilos CSS, você pode usar o important dentro do style da sua tabela:
Código:
style="border: 1px solid #4080FF !important; padding: 10px 10px 10px 10px; width: 90%; margin-left: 5%; margin-right: 5%; border-radius: 10px 10px 10px 10px; -moz-border-radius: 10px 10px 10px 10px; -webkit-border-radius: 10px 10px 10px 10px; border-radius: 10px 10px 5px #A0A0A0; -moz-border-radius: 10px 10px 5px #A0A0A0; -webkit-border-radius: 10px 10px 5px #A0A0A0;"
Tente declarar o transparent no código que mencionei e depois, use o !important no seu style dentro da tabela após a propriedade border.

Até mais.
Shek

Shek
Principal Contribuidor
Principal Contribuidor

Membro desde : 11/04/2009
Mensagens : 19006
Pontos : 22969

https://shiftactive.blogspot.com/ https://www.facebook.com/ShiftActif https://twitter.com/ShiftActif

Ir para o topo Ir para baixo

Tópico resolvido Re: border no CSS base

Mensagem por Eduardo Lima 17.05.18 21:30

Já tinha feito isso, só queria saber se tinha algum jeito de retirar esse código do CSS base do fórum, mas acho que não.


Obrigado, Shek. Colegas
avatar

Eduardo Lima
****

Membro desde : 07/03/2016
Mensagens : 243
Pontos : 380

http://www.brasilplayforever.com/forum

Ir para o topo Ir para baixo

Tópico resolvido Re: border no CSS base

Mensagem por Alex 18.05.18 9:33

Tópico resolvido


Movido para "Questões resolvidas".
Alex

Alex
Membro

Membro desde : 09/09/2016
Mensagens : 651
Pontos : 883

https://policiadop.com/

Ir para o topo Ir para baixo

Ver o tópico anterior Ver o tópico seguinte Ir para o topo

- Tópicos semelhantes

Permissões neste sub-fórum
Não podes responder a tópicos